Haryana Leather Chemicals Limited has announced its un-audited financial results for the quarter ended June 30, 2026. The Board of Directors approved the financial statements during a meeting held on August 10, 2026, marking the company's compliance with statutory disclosure timelines for the initial quarter of the fiscal year. The results provide investors with an early view of the company's operational performance following the close of the previous financial year.

The announcement was filed pursuant to Regulation 33 read with Regulation 47(1) of the SEBI (Listing Obligations and Disclosure Requirements) Regulations, 2015. Pankaj Jain, Managing Director of Haryana Leather Chemicals Ltd., authorized the release of the results on behalf of the Board. The filing ensures transparency and adherence to regulatory standards set by the Securities and Exchange Board of India.

The Board of Directors of Haryana Leather Chemicals Limited has approved the continuation of Pankaj Jain as Chairman and Managing Director beyond the statutory age limit of 70 years. The decision, taken during a meeting held on August 8, 2026, ensures leadership stability for the chemical manufacturer but remains subject to ratification by shareholders at the company’s ensuing Annual General Meeting. This move allows Jain to continue his tenure despite being liable to retire by rotation due to age regulations.

The Board’s approval follows a recommendation from the Nomination and Remuneration Committee. Under Section 164(2) of the Companies Act, 2013, no person above the age of 70 years can be appointed as a director unless a special resolution is passed by the members of the company. Consequently, Haryana Leather Chemicals Limited will seek shareholder consent through a special resolution at the upcoming AGM to validate Jain’s continued directorship. The filing confirms that Mr. Jain is not debarred from holding office by any order passed by the Securities and Exchange Board of India (SEBI) or any other regulatory authority.

Leadership Profile and Tenure

Pankaj Jain (DIN: 00206564) has served as the Managing Director since February 4, 2013. The company highlights his role in conceptualizing the establishment of Haryana Leather Chemicals Limited and designing its organizational structure and control systems. According to the disclosure, Jain has been instrumental in the company’s growth and diversification, expanding its presence to global markets. He currently devotes his full time to the growth and diversification strategies of the firm.

Regulatory Compliance

The disclosure was made in compliance with Regulation 30 of the SEBI (Listing Obligations and Disclosure Requirements) Regulations, 2015. The filing also references specific SEBI circulars: SEBI/HO/CFD/CFD-PoD-1/P/CIR/2023/123 dated July 13, 2023, and HO/49/14/14(7)2025-CFD-POD2/I/3762/2026 dated January 30, 2026. These circulars mandate detailed disclosures regarding changes in key managerial personnel and directors attaining the age of 70 years.
